The thermit welding approach was identified by the German chemist Hans Goldschmidt in 1895, who recognised which the aluminothermic response involving aluminium powder and metal oxides created ample warmth to provide liquid metallic.

The molten iron existing at The underside on the crucible and slag of aluminium oxide floats above the molten steel. The crucible includes a taping unit to discharge the molten metal towards the mold with the welding.
The warmth-creating chemical response results in a pure molten iron or alloy iron and an aluminum slag. The slag floats over the comparatively pure iron area and is also expelled, as we’ll discuss shortly.
